Soil Preparation and Its Impact on Leaf Flavor
Prioritize soil testing before planting. Conduct analysis for pH, organic matter, and nutrient levels. Optimal pH for tobacco typically ranges from 5.5 to 7.0. Amend soil based on test results, using lime to adjust acidity or sulfur to lower pH.
Incorporate organic matter, such as compost or well-rotted manure, to improve soil structure and nutrient content. This enhances microbial activity, which contributes to nutrient availability for plants. Aim for 3-5% organic matter for ideal conditions.
Implement crop rotation to prevent nutrient depletion and reduce pest issues. Avoid planting tobacco in the same field consecutively, as this can lead to soil-borne diseases and nutrient imbalance.
Regularly monitor moisture levels, ensuring adequate drainage to prevent waterlogging. Excess water can impair root development, affecting flavor during growth. Adjust irrigation practices based on weather conditions and plant needs.
Consider using cover crops before the main planting. Legumes can add nitrogen to the soil, improving fertility for tobacco plants. When incorporated into the soil, they enhance both nutrient content and microbial diversity.
Attention to soil texture contributes to leaf quality. Sandy loam is often preferred, striking a balance between drainage and nutrient retention. Adjust soil composition if necessary, using organic amendments to create suitable conditions.
Maintain proper weed control, as competition for nutrients and water can adversely affect plant health and flavor. Use mulching or mechanical methods to manage weed growth without harming soil integrity.
The Growing Conditions: Sunlight, Water, and Timing
Choose full sun exposure, ensuring plants receive at least 6 to 8 hours of direct sunlight daily. This facilitates optimal photosynthesis, promoting robust leaf development.
Maintain consistent moisture; plants require well-drained soil that retains some dampness. Watering should be about 1 to 1.5 inches weekly, adjusting during dry spells to avoid stress.
Timing is pivotal. Plant seedlings after the last frost, allowing ample time for maturation before fall. Typically, a growth period of 70 to 90 days is necessary, depending on the varietal. Monitoring local climate forecasts assists in planning the planting schedule effectively.
Soil temperature impacts germination; strive for a range of 65°F to 75°F. Conduct soil tests to ensure nutrient balance and pH levels around 6.0 to 7.0 for ideal growth conditions.
Consistent monitoring for pests and diseases enhances crop health. Incorporate crop rotation and companion planting to naturally deter harmful species.

Fermentation: Balancing Moisture and Temperature
Maintain humidity levels between 70% and 80% during fermentation. This range optimizes chemical reactions and enhances flavor development. Keep a consistent temperature between 70°F and 75°F. Fluctuations can lead to unwanted molds or spoilage.
Moisture Control
Use hygrometers and humidity control systems to monitor moisture. Excessive humidity can cause leaf damage, while low humidity can dry out the tobacco, impacting its aromatic qualities. Regularly check the moisture content of leaves, aiming for around 16% to ensure proper fermentation.
Temperature Regulation
Utilize temperature-controlled environments, such as climate-controlled warehouses. Insulation and ventilation are crucial to prevent heat buildup and ensure even temperatures throughout the batch. Avoid direct sunlight and sudden drafts that can disrupt the fermentation process.
Rolling and Aging: Crafting the Perfect Cigar
For achieving peak enjoyment, focus on both rolling and aging stages meticulously.
Rolling Techniques
- Choose high-quality leaves: Select well-fermented wrappers, binders, and fillers.
- Maintain humidity: Working within optimal moisture levels ensures elasticity and prevents cracking.
- Consistent pressure: Apply uniform pressure during rolling to avoid uneven burning later.
- Shape matters: Decide on shapes like torpedo, parejo, or figurado based on desired smoking characteristics.
- Fine-tuning: Test the draw by gently squeezing; adjust tight spots to facilitate airflow.
Aging Recommendations
- Storage conditions: Keep cigars in a humidor with 65-75% humidity and 65-70°F (18-21°C) temperature.
- Duration: Aim for at least 3 months of aging for flavor development; longer aging enhances complexity.
- Rotation: Regularly rotate cigars within humidor to ensure even humidity exposure.
- Pairing: Consider aging with cedar wood, which can further enhance aroma and flavor.
By implementing precise rolling techniques and optimal aging conditions, one can significantly elevate the smoking experience.
Q&A: How cigars are made
What role does the wrapper leaf play in the cigar making process and how does it affect the smoker’s experience?
The wrapper leaf is the outermost part of the cigar and plays a critical role in both the appearance and flavor of a premium cigar. This piece of tobacco is carefully selected for its smooth texture, even color, and aromatic quality. As it’s the first part of the cigar to touch the smoker’s lips and palate, the wrapper leaf can significantly influence the taste, contributing notes that range from spicy to sweet, depending on the type of tobacco used.
How are filler leaves and binder leaf combined to create the body of the cigar during the hand-rolled cigar production?
During the hand-rolled cigar process, filler leaves are selected for their burn quality and flavor characteristics, then wrapped in a binder leaf to hold the filler together. This combination forms the body of the cigar and directly impacts how the cigar burns and draws. Cigar rollers in regions like Cuba and the Dominican Republic use their expertise to arrange different types of tobacco leaves to create a balanced blend that defines the strength and complexity of every cigar.
Why is the aging process essential in producing high-quality cigars from harvested tobacco?
The aging process allows harvested tobacco to develop richer, more refined flavors by removing harsh chemicals like ammonia and balancing the leaf’s natural oils. In premium cigar production, tobacco leaves are aged for months or even years before they’re used, ensuring that the final tobacco product offers smoothness and depth. This step is crucial in making a handmade cigar that satisfies even the most discerning cigar aficionados.
